Transaction 34f52ee454b4359e7efc50a14769667d6a6f50ff4acfb06bb2f9e615aa705f2f
1 Input
1 Output
-
34f52ee454b4359e7efc50a14769667d6a6f50ff4acfb06bb2f9e615aa705f2f:0
- value
- 7703557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 438ecf6bb54bb60d5ab14a03e7570b42662cba59 OP_EQUAL
- address
- 37rEH2SUcKnWJcwVWoEqCFUPoVeWkxddQX